What Are the Costs of Running a Software as a Service Business?

Oct 5, 2024

Are you ready to take your Software As A Service (SaaS) business to the next level? As the industry continues to experience exponential growth, it's essential for entrepreneurs and small business owners to understand the intricacies of managing operating expenses. With the potential for high profits, it's crucial to have a clear understanding of the costs involved in running a SaaS business.

The SaaS industry has seen a staggering 24% annual growth over the past five years, with no signs of slowing down. This presents a tremendous opportunity for those looking to enter the market, but it also means a greater need for careful financial planning. Running a successful SaaS business requires sound financial management, particularly when it comes to operating expenses.

Join us as we delve into the world of managing operating expenses for SaaS businesses. We'll explore the potential costs involved and provide valuable insights into how to effectively plan and budget for these essential aspects of running a successful business. Don't miss out on this opportunity to gain a deeper understanding of the financial side of entrepreneurship.

Stay tuned for our upcoming blog post!


Operating Costs

Operating costs are the expenses associated with running a business on a day-to-day basis. These costs include everything from employee salaries and benefits to cloud hosting and infrastructure expenses, as well as marketing and sales activities, and cybersecurity measures.

Expenditure Minimum, USD Maximum, USD Average, USD
Cloud hosting and infrastructure costs 1,000 5,000 3,000
Software licensing and royalty fees 500 2,000 1,250
Continuous software development and maintenance 2,000 10,000 6,000
Data storage and management expenses 800 3,000 1,900
Customer support and success operations 1,500 6,000 3,750
Cybersecurity measures and data protection 2,500 12,000 7,250
Compliance and legal fees 1,200 5,000 3,100
Marketing and sales activities 3,000 15,000 9,000
Employee salaries and benefits 10,000 50,000 30,000
Total 22,500 118,000 70,250

Cloud hosting and infrastructure costs

When it comes to Software as a Service (SaaS) businesses, cloud hosting and infrastructure costs are a significant part of the operating expenses. These costs cover the infrastructure needed to host and deliver the software over the internet, including servers, storage, networking, and virtualization. Understanding the average cost ranges, influencing factors, budgeting tips, and cost-saving strategies for these expenses is crucial for SaaS businesses to effectively manage their finances.

Average Cost Ranges

The average cost of cloud hosting and infrastructure for a SaaS business typically ranges from $1,000 to $5,000 per month, with an average of $3,000. These costs can vary based on the size of the business, the complexity of the software, and the level of scalability and performance required.

Influencing Factors

Several key factors influence the cost of cloud hosting and infrastructure for SaaS businesses. These include the amount of data storage and processing power required, the level of security and compliance measures needed, the choice of cloud service provider, and the need for high availability and redundancy. Additionally, factors such as geographic location, data transfer costs, and usage patterns can also impact the overall expenses.

Tips for Budgeting

For effective budgeting of cloud hosting and infrastructure costs, SaaS businesses should consider several practical tips. Firstly, it's essential to accurately assess the current and future needs of the business to avoid over-provisioning or under-provisioning resources. Secondly, leveraging cost estimation tools provided by cloud service providers can help in forecasting expenses. Additionally, monitoring and optimizing resource usage, implementing automation, and negotiating pricing with providers can contribute to better budget management.

Cost-Saving Strategies

To reduce cloud hosting and infrastructure costs, SaaS businesses can employ various strategies. One approach is to utilize reserved instances or spot instances offered by cloud providers, which can result in significant cost savings. Implementing efficient resource utilization, adopting serverless architectures, and optimizing data storage and retrieval processes can also help in lowering expenses. Furthermore, exploring multi-cloud or hybrid cloud solutions and periodically reviewing and adjusting infrastructure requirements can contribute to cost reduction.


Business Plan Template

Software As A Service Business Plan

  • User-Friendly: Edit with ease in familiar MS Word.
  • Beginner-Friendly: Edit with ease, even if you're new to business planning.
  • Investor-Ready: Create plans that attract and engage potential investors.
  • Instant Download: Start crafting your business plan right away.


Software licensing and royalty fees

Software licensing and royalty fees are a crucial part of the operating costs for businesses that rely on Software as a Service (SaaS) models. These fees are associated with the use of third-party software and technologies, and they can significantly impact the overall budget of a SaaS company.

Average Cost Ranges

The average cost of software licensing and royalty fees typically ranges from $500 to $2,000 per month for SaaS startups. However, this can vary based on the specific software solutions and technologies being utilized. Larger enterprises may incur higher costs, reaching up to $10,000 per month or more, depending on the scale of their operations and the complexity of the software systems they employ.

Influencing Factors

Several key factors influence the cost of software licensing and royalty fees for SaaS businesses. The complexity and functionality of the software, the number of users or licenses required, and the specific terms and conditions set by the software providers can all impact the overall expenses. Additionally, the need for ongoing updates, support, and maintenance can contribute to the total cost.

Tips for Budgeting

To effectively budget for software licensing and royalty fees, SaaS businesses should carefully assess their software needs and usage requirements. It's essential to conduct thorough research on available software solutions, negotiate favorable terms with vendors, and consider scalability and future growth when making budgeting decisions. Implementing robust software usage tracking and monitoring systems can also help in optimizing costs and avoiding unnecessary expenses.

  • Conduct a comprehensive analysis of software requirements and usage patterns
  • Negotiate favorable terms and pricing with software vendors
  • Implement robust usage tracking and monitoring systems
  • Consider scalability and future growth when making budgeting decisions

Cost-Saving Strategies

Businesses can employ several strategies to reduce software licensing and royalty fees without compromising on the quality and functionality of their software systems. This includes exploring open-source or more cost-effective alternatives, optimizing software usage to eliminate unnecessary licenses, and leveraging volume discounts or long-term contracts with software providers.

  • Explore open-source or more cost-effective software alternatives
  • Optimize software usage to eliminate unnecessary licenses
  • Leverage volume discounts or long-term contracts with software providers
  • Regularly review and reassess software needs to identify potential cost-saving opportunities


Continuous software development and maintenance

Continuous software development and maintenance are essential for the success of any Software as a Service (SaaS) business. It involves the ongoing process of improving, updating, and fixing software to ensure that it meets the evolving needs of users and remains competitive in the market.

Average Cost Ranges

Continuous software development and maintenance costs can vary significantly depending on the size and complexity of the software, as well as the specific needs of the business. On average, businesses can expect to spend between $2,000 to $10,000 per month on these activities. However, the actual costs can fall anywhere between $6,000 to $30,000 annually, depending on the scale and scope of the software.

Influencing Factors

Several key factors can influence the cost of continuous software development and maintenance. These include the size and complexity of the software, the frequency of updates and improvements, the need for specialized skills and expertise, and the level of support and resources required. Additionally, external factors such as market trends, technological advancements, and regulatory changes can also impact these costs.

Tips for Budgeting

Effective budgeting for continuous software development and maintenance requires careful planning and consideration of various factors. Businesses can start by conducting a thorough assessment of their software needs and setting clear objectives for development and maintenance activities. It is also important to prioritize critical updates and allocate resources accordingly. Additionally, businesses should regularly review and adjust their budgets based on changing requirements and market conditions.

  • Conduct a thorough assessment of software needs
  • Set clear objectives for development and maintenance
  • Prioritize critical updates and allocate resources accordingly
  • Regularly review and adjust budgets based on changing requirements and market conditions

Cost-Saving Strategies

Businesses can employ several strategies to reduce the costs associated with continuous software development and maintenance. One approach is to leverage open-source software and development tools, which can significantly lower licensing and royalty fees. Outsourcing certain development and maintenance tasks to offshore or remote teams can also provide cost savings while maintaining quality. Additionally, implementing efficient project management and development processes can help minimize unnecessary expenses and improve overall productivity.

  • Leverage open-source software and development tools
  • Outsource development and maintenance tasks to offshore or remote teams
  • Implement efficient project management and development processes


Data storage and management expenses

Average Cost Ranges

When it comes to data storage and management expenses, businesses can expect to spend an average of USD 800 to 3,000 per month. This cost includes the storage of data, as well as the tools and systems required to manage and organize that data effectively.

Influencing Factors

Several key factors can influence the cost of data storage and management. The size of the business and the volume of data it generates and stores is a significant factor. Additionally, the level of security and compliance requirements, as well as the need for advanced data management features, can also impact the overall expense.

Tips for Budgeting

Businesses can effectively budget for data storage and management expenses by first assessing their current and future data storage needs. It's essential to consider scalability and potential growth when budgeting for these expenses. Additionally, exploring different storage and management solutions to find the most cost-effective option can help in budgeting effectively.

  • Assess current and future data storage needs
  • Consider scalability and potential growth
  • Explore different storage and management solutions

Cost-Saving Strategies

To reduce data storage and management expenses, businesses can consider implementing data archiving and tiered storage solutions to optimize storage costs. Additionally, leveraging cloud-based storage options and implementing data deduplication and compression techniques can help in reducing the overall expense.

  • Implement data archiving and tiered storage solutions
  • Leverage cloud-based storage options
  • Implement data deduplication and compression techniques


Customer support and success operations

Customer support and success operations are crucial for the success of any Software as a Service (SaaS) business. These operations encompass activities such as providing technical assistance, resolving customer issues, and ensuring customer satisfaction and retention.

Average Cost Ranges

The average cost of customer support and success operations for a SaaS business typically ranges from $1,500 to $6,000 per month. This includes expenses related to hiring and training support staff, implementing customer success programs, and investing in customer relationship management (CRM) tools.

Influencing Factors

Several key factors influence the cost of customer support and success operations for a SaaS business. These factors include the size of the customer base, the complexity of the software product, the level of technical expertise required for support, and the quality of customer success initiatives. Additionally, the geographic location of the support team and the need for multilingual support can also impact costs.

Tips for Budgeting

To effectively budget for customer support and success operations, SaaS businesses should consider implementing the following tips:

  • Invest in training: Providing comprehensive training to support staff can improve efficiency and reduce the need for additional resources.
  • Utilize self-service options: Implementing self-service support options, such as knowledge bases and FAQs, can reduce the workload on support teams and lower costs.
  • Monitor and analyze metrics: Tracking key performance indicators (KPIs) related to customer support and success can help identify areas for improvement and optimize resource allocation.

Cost-Saving Strategies

Businesses can employ the following strategies to reduce the expenses associated with customer support and success operations:

  • Outsourcing support: Utilizing third-party support services or outsourcing non-core support functions can lower operational costs.
  • Implementing automation: Leveraging automation tools for ticket management, chatbots, and customer communication can streamline processes and reduce the need for manual intervention.
  • Encouraging self-service: Promoting self-service options and empowering customers to find solutions independently can decrease the demand for direct support.


Business Plan Template

Software As A Service Business Plan

  • Cost-Effective: Get premium quality without the premium price tag.
  • Increases Chances of Success: Start with a proven framework for success.
  • Tailored to Your Needs: Fully customizable to fit your unique business vision.
  • Accessible Anywhere: Start planning on any device with MS Word or Google Docs.


Cybersecurity measures and data protection

When it comes to operating a Software as a Service (SaaS) business, cybersecurity measures and data protection are crucial components that require careful consideration. Ensuring the security and privacy of customer data is not only a legal requirement but also essential for maintaining trust and credibility with clients.

Average Cost Ranges

The average cost of cybersecurity measures and data protection for a SaaS business typically ranges from $2,500 to $12,000 per month. This includes expenses related to implementing security protocols, encryption technologies, and data protection measures to safeguard sensitive information from unauthorized access or breaches.

Influencing Factors

Several key factors can influence the cost of cybersecurity measures and data protection for a SaaS business. These factors include the size and complexity of the software infrastructure, the volume of customer data being handled, the level of regulatory compliance required, and the potential risk of cyber threats and attacks.

Tips for Budgeting

  • Conduct a thorough risk assessment to identify potential vulnerabilities and prioritize security needs.
  • Invest in scalable security solutions that can adapt to the evolving needs of the business.
  • Allocate a dedicated budget for ongoing security monitoring, updates, and training to ensure continuous protection.
  • Consider outsourcing certain security functions to specialized third-party providers to optimize costs.

Cost-Saving Strategies

  • Implementing multi-factor authentication and access controls to minimize the risk of unauthorized access.
  • Leveraging open-source security tools and technologies to reduce licensing and royalty fees.
  • Consolidating data storage and management systems to optimize resource utilization and reduce expenses.
  • Regularly reviewing and updating security policies and procedures to proactively address potential vulnerabilities.


Compliance and legal fees

Compliance and legal fees are an essential part of operating a Software as a Service (SaaS) business. These expenses cover the costs associated with ensuring that the company complies with relevant laws and regulations, as well as any legal fees incurred in the course of business operations.

Average Cost Ranges

The average cost of compliance and legal fees for a SaaS startup typically ranges from $1,200 to $5,000. This includes expenses related to obtaining necessary licenses, permits, and certifications, as well as legal consultation and representation.

Influencing Factors

Several key factors can influence the cost of compliance and legal fees for a SaaS business. These factors include the complexity of regulatory requirements, the need for specialized legal expertise, and the geographic location of the business. Additionally, the size and scale of the SaaS operations can also impact the overall cost of compliance and legal fees.

Tips for Budgeting

When budgeting for compliance and legal fees, it is important for SaaS businesses to allocate sufficient resources for legal counsel and compliance activities. This may involve engaging with experienced legal professionals who specialize in technology and SaaS regulations. It is also advisable to stay informed about changes in relevant laws and regulations to anticipate potential compliance costs.

  • Allocate a dedicated budget for compliance and legal fees
  • Engage with specialized legal professionals
  • Stay informed about regulatory changes

Cost-Saving Strategies

To reduce compliance and legal fees, SaaS businesses can consider implementing cost-saving strategies such as leveraging technology for compliance management, negotiating favorable terms with legal service providers, and investing in proactive risk management to minimize legal exposure.

  • Leverage technology for compliance management
  • Negotiate favorable terms with legal service providers
  • Invest in proactive risk management


Business Plan Template

Software As A Service Business Plan

  • Effortless Customization: Tailor each aspect to your needs.
  • Professional Layout: Present your a polished, expert look.
  • Cost-Effective: Save money without compromising on quality.
  • Instant Access: Start planning immediately.


Marketing and sales activities

Marketing and sales activities are crucial for the success of any Software as a Service (SaaS) business. These activities encompass a wide range of expenses, including advertising, promotions, lead generation, and sales team salaries and commissions. It is essential for SaaS companies to allocate a significant portion of their operating budget to marketing and sales activities in order to attract and retain customers.

Average Cost Ranges

The average cost ranges for marketing and sales activities in a SaaS business typically fall between $3,000 to $15,000 per month. These costs can vary based on the size of the target market, the competitiveness of the industry, and the specific marketing and sales strategies employed by the company.

Influencing Factors

Several key factors can influence the cost of marketing and sales activities for a SaaS business. These factors include the chosen marketing channels (such as digital advertising, content marketing, or social media), the complexity of the sales process, the level of competition in the market, and the target customer demographics. Additionally, the cost of marketing and sales activities can be impacted by the need for specialized talent, such as experienced sales professionals or digital marketing experts.

Tips for Budgeting

When budgeting for marketing and sales activities, SaaS businesses should consider the following tips to effectively allocate their resources:

  • Set clear goals: Define specific marketing and sales objectives to guide budget allocation and measure performance.
  • Invest in analytics: Utilize data and analytics tools to track the effectiveness of marketing and sales efforts and optimize spending.
  • Focus on ROI: Prioritize investments in marketing and sales activities that are likely to generate a positive return on investment.
  • Regularly review and adjust: Continuously monitor the performance of marketing and sales initiatives and make adjustments as needed to optimize spending.

Cost-Saving Strategies

To reduce the expenses associated with marketing and sales activities, SaaS businesses can implement the following cost-saving strategies:

  • Utilize inbound marketing: Focus on creating valuable content and leveraging SEO to attract organic traffic and reduce reliance on paid advertising.
  • Implement marketing automation: Use automation tools to streamline marketing processes and improve efficiency, reducing the need for additional manpower.
  • Optimize sales processes: Invest in sales enablement tools and training to improve the productivity and effectiveness of the sales team, ultimately reducing costs per acquisition.
  • Explore partnerships: Collaborate with complementary businesses or industry influencers to expand reach and reduce the need for extensive advertising spend.


Employee salaries and benefits

Employee salaries and benefits are a significant part of the operating costs for businesses, especially for those in the software as a service (SaaS) industry. These expenses encompass the compensation and perks provided to employees, including wages, bonuses, health insurance, retirement plans, and other benefits.

Average Cost Ranges

The average cost of employee salaries and benefits for a SaaS startup typically ranges from $10,000 to $50,000 per month. This amount can vary based on the size of the company, the location of the business, and the level of experience and expertise required for the roles.

Influencing Factors

Several key factors influence the cost of employee salaries and benefits. These include the geographical location of the business, the industry standards for compensation, the skill level and experience of the employees, and the company's financial position. Additionally, the benefits package offered by the company, such as healthcare coverage, retirement plans, and other perks, can also impact the overall cost.

Tips for Budgeting

Businesses can effectively budget for employee salaries and benefits by conducting thorough market research to understand the prevailing compensation rates in their industry and location. It is essential to create a detailed budget that accounts for all aspects of employee compensation, including base salaries, bonuses, and benefits. Additionally, regularly reviewing and adjusting the budget based on the company's financial performance and growth projections can help in effective budgeting.

  • Conduct market research to understand industry standards for compensation.
  • Create a detailed budget that includes all aspects of employee compensation.
  • Regularly review and adjust the budget based on financial performance and growth projections.

Cost-Saving Strategies

Businesses can employ several strategies to reduce the expenses associated with employee salaries and benefits. This includes outsourcing certain functions to reduce the need for full-time employees, implementing performance-based compensation structures, and leveraging technology to streamline HR processes and reduce administrative costs. Additionally, offering flexible work arrangements and remote work options can help in attracting top talent while reducing overhead costs.

  • Outsource certain functions to reduce the need for full-time employees.
  • Implement performance-based compensation structures.
  • Leverage technology to streamline HR processes and reduce administrative costs.
  • Offer flexible work arrangements and remote work options.


Business Plan Template

Software As A Service Business Plan

  • No Special Software Needed: Edit in MS Word or Google Sheets.
  • Collaboration-Friendly: Share & edit with team members.
  • Time-Saving: Jumpstart your planning with pre-written sections.
  • Instant Access: Start planning immediately.